What is non-medical home care?


Non-medical home care refers to supportive services provided in the home that do not involve medical treatment or nursing tasks. Instead, this care focuses on helping with everyday activities that might become challenging with age or disability. These services include:


  • Assistance with bathing, dressing, and grooming.

  • Help with meal preparation and feeding.

  • Light housekeeping and laundry.

  • Transportation to appointments or errands.

  • Companionship and social engagement.

  • Medication reminders (without administering medications).


This type of care is designed to promote independence and safety while allowing seniors to remain in familiar surroundings. It is often provided by trained caregivers who understand the importance of empathy, respect, and patience.

Practical tips for choosing the right non-medical care


Selecting the right care provider is a decision that requires thoughtful consideration. Here are some practical tips to guide us through the process:


  1. Assess the specific needs of your loved one. What daily tasks are most challenging? What kind of companionship do they prefer?

  2. Research local providers with strong reputations and positive reviews.

  3. Ask about caregiver training and background checks to ensure safety and professionalism.

  4. Discuss scheduling options to find a plan that fits your family’s lifestyle.

  5. Request a trial period to observe how the caregiver interacts and adapts.

  6. Communicate openly with the care team about any changes or concerns.


By taking these steps, we can build a trusting relationship that supports both our loved ones and ourselves.
